夜になるまえに
We witness moments when particles of light rise into the world as traces.
People notice, overlook, remember, and forget—
not by will, but as these moments quietly disperse within the flow of time.
Just before general anesthesia, in the brief instant before consciousness fades,
I remember seeing images drift across the back of my retina.
The boundary between reality and memory loosened,
and the world seemed to tremble, still made only of particles.
Before existence is fixed into form,
might it not seep into the world as a trace?
On a layer different from the bodily boundaries of life and death,
the time and feelings carried by living beings and things sink into light,
quietly continuing somewhere within the world.
Around the moment an image becomes fixed as a photograph,
there may be particles of light that rise, sink, and drift away.
Within that wavering, I sense something certain, quietly concealed.
This exhibition is a place to dwell within that layer of fluctuation,
and to calmly face the subtle presence of the world before it becomes an image.
Drawing close to the traces that surface in the world,
following those fragile connections,
I wish to quietly weave a story.
